I got this for free from MC, and tried to put it on, when i realized i didnt have the right sized allen wrench to do it. This is a negative, as i had to go out and buy a hex key (same thing) just to install this, even though i had several hex keys in my garage. FYI, it is sized 0.050, which is very small. when you tighten the screws, the shoe has a tendency to slide up a little bit due to the nature of how it stays in position, by tightening the small screws onto the trigger (imagine, the screws are being tightened while being in contact with the trigger, and as the screw rolls in a circle it slowly pushes the trigger shoe up). Honestly, i loved the stock trigger, albeit the pictures make the stock trigger seem like it will cut your finger, but since i got this for free i use it. Honestly i dont really care on if i have one or not, but i keep it on since like i said, i got it for free. Also, in terms of appearance, i feel that it looks much better with a shoe, as it can match your color scheme. Another positive is that it allows you to grab the trigger easier, since the shoe makes the trigger wider. However, this being said, it does make less room for your fingers, so if you use gloves or have fat fingers, it might be a problem. it isnt for me though
